These are literally CRIMINALS who are phishing for credit card numbers.  They are faking their caller ID.  The FTC is working on nabbing them.  Talking to them or asking them to stop calling is pointless (if anything it will get you put on a 'live person' list so you will receive even more calls).  If you feel compelled to fight back, pretend to be genuinely interested but give them fake credit card numbers to pollute their list.

Criminals like these would be much easier to track down if it was harder to fake the caller ID.  Search for the "truth in caller ID" act of 2010 to learn more.

If you are with Bresnan Communications and getting these calls, one of their phone techs told me you can press STAR 60, wait for a confirmation message, then put in the 10-digit harrassing number, and you'll get a message that the number has been added to a blocked list of numbers. You can do this for up to 12 numbers. Well, I'm certainly going to try this!
